| Quarter | Electricity | Gas | Dual Fuel | Notes |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Q1 2024 | £1,928 | £1,459 | £1,928 | - |
| Q2 2024 | £1,690 | £1,273 | £1,690 | - |
| Q3 2024 | £1,568 | £1,184 | £1,568 | - |
| Q4 2024 | £1,717 | £1,294 | £1,717 | - |
Source: Ofgem (Office of Gas and Electricity Markets), UK Government
Coverage: 23 price cap periods from 2019 to 2025
Typical Household Consumption: Electricity ~2,900 kWh/year, Gas ~12,000 kWh/year
All prices are annual price caps in British Pounds (£) for customers on default tariffs. The Energy Price Guarantee was a temporary government support measure during the energy crisis.
